Reconhecendo o código de barras PDF417 com caracteres turcos em Java
Introdução
Os códigos de barras são uma parte essencial das operações comerciais modernas, fornecendo uma maneira simplificada de gerenciar e rastrear dados. Aspose.BarCode for Java é uma biblioteca poderosa que permite aos desenvolvedores trabalhar com códigos de barras perfeitamente. Neste tutorial, iremos guiá-lo através do processo de reconhecimento de códigos de barras PDF417 com caracteres turcos usando Aspose.BarCode para Java.
Pré-requisitos
Antes de mergulharmos no tutorial, certifique-se de ter o seguinte:
- Ambiente de Desenvolvimento Java: Certifique-se de ter o Java instalado em seu sistema.
- Biblioteca Aspose.BarCode para Java: Baixe e configure a biblioteca Aspose.BarCode para Java. Você pode encontrar o link para download aqui .
Importar pacotes
No seu projeto Java, inclua os pacotes necessários para trabalhar com Aspose.BarCode:
import java.nio.ByteBuffer;
import java.nio.charset.Charset;
import com.aspose.barcode.barcoderecognition.BarCodeReader;
import com.aspose.barcode.barcoderecognition.BarCodeResult;
import com.aspose.barcode.barcoderecognition.DecodeType;
Etapa 1: configure seu projeto
Crie um novo projeto Java e inclua a biblioteca Aspose.BarCode. Se você ainda não baixou, acesse esse link para o download.
Etapa 2: carregar imagem de código de barras
Defina o caminho para o seu diretório de recursos e carregue a imagem do código de barras:
String dataDir = "Your Document Directory";
BarCodeReader reader = new BarCodeReader(dataDir + "barcode.png", DecodeType.PDF_417);
Etapa 3: leia o código de barras
Use o BarCodeReader para ler o código de barras:
for (BarCodeResult result : reader.readBarCodes()) {
byte[] bytes = result.getCodeBytes();
ByteBuffer bytebuf = ByteBuffer.wrap(bytes);
System.out.println(Charset.forName("windows-1254").decode(bytebuf).toString());
}
Este trecho de código lê o código de barras PDF417 e decodifica a matriz de bytes para exibir caracteres turcos.
Conclusão
Com Aspose.BarCode for Java, reconhecer códigos de barras PDF417 com caracteres turcos torna-se um processo simples. As etapas descritas acima orientam você na integração da biblioteca em seu projeto Java, carregando a imagem do código de barras e lendo o conteúdo do código de barras.
perguntas frequentes
O Aspose.BarCode é compatível com diferentes tipos de códigos de barras?
Sim, Aspose.BarCode oferece suporte a uma ampla variedade de tipos de códigos de barras, incluindo PDF417.
Posso usar Aspose.BarCode para projetos comerciais?
Absolutamente. Aspose.BarCode vem com um modelo de licenciamento flexível adequado para uso pessoal e comercial. Visita aqui para explorar opções de licenciamento.
Existe um teste gratuito disponível?
Sim, você pode acessar um teste gratuito aqui .
Como posso obter suporte para Aspose.BarCode?
Visite a Fórum Aspose.BarCode para obter suporte da comunidade ou explorar a documentação aqui .
Posso usar uma licença temporária durante o desenvolvimento?
Sim, você pode obter uma licença temporária aqui .